  2. Football Season 2015/16

    As a supporter of a League Two team (playing in League One next season!), I'm for the idea in principle but do have a few concerns on how it will be implemented and supported. The largest benefit would be to alleviate fixture congestion. Oxford United played 60 matches this season, by virtue of doing well in Cup competitions. Often meant we were playing every Saturday and every Tuesday, and I believe it really affected our form around February and March. We were lucky that we didn't have any major injuries during this period. Obviously a big concern is that fewer fixtures mean fewer matchdays for clubs to earn revenue from (although you would expect average attendances to be higher as there would be fewer midweek games, aggregate attendance over the season would still be lower I imagine). Football League clubs would need some kind of guarantee that this shake-up would galvanise interest in the divisions, rather than further marginalise the clubs that would inevitably be put in "League Three". On a side note, I hope they address the bottleneck between League Two and the Conference in terms of promotion/relegation. Conference has really become an unbalance league with so many former FL clubs queuing up for only 2 promotion spots. Should really be 3 up and 3 down. Would also love play-offs to be scrapped in all leagues, but I don't see that happening.

  23. What's your internet speed like?

    My parent's house has 6mb. It works perfectly fine for gaming, was also watching a lot of Netflix without too much trouble. The problems arise when you have multiple people in the house sharing the same connection. I live with 2 other nerdy people who like to stream a lot and having 100mb fibre means my online gaming is not really affected that much by other people streaming or downloading stuff. The most important aspects for gaming in my opinion are ping and reliability. I remember being 'that guy' on Destiny a year ago where my connection would be fine for hours and then just drop off the edge of a cliff. Make sure you go with a good ISP who won't throttle your connection in the middle of a raid!
